The legendary Tata Sierra has officially returned to the Indian automotive market, and the response has been nothing short of historic. On the very first day of bookings, Tata Motors received over 70,000 confirmed orders, signaling massive consumer interest and a strong shift in the mid-size SUV segment.
This overwhelming demand positions the new Tata Sierra as a serious challenger to established SUVs, proving that nostalgia combined with modern technology can still dominate the market.
Tesla Expands Its EV Charging Footprint in India
In a parallel boost to India’s electric mobility ecosystem, Tesla has inaugurated a new high-speed charging station at Horizon Center, Gurugram. Located in the Surface Parking Area, the facility is designed to support both quick top-ups and longer charging sessions, catering to a wide range of EV users.

V4 Superchargers Deliver Ultra-Fast Charging Speeds
The newly launched charging hub is equipped with advanced infrastructure, including:
- 4 V4 Superchargers offering peak charging speeds of up to 250 kW
- 3 Destination Chargers with a charging capacity of 11 kW
These high-performance chargers significantly reduce charging time for long-distance travelers.
Tesla Model Y Can Gain 275 km Range in Just 15 Minutes
Tesla highlighted the real-world benefits of its V4 Superchargers by stating that a Tesla Model Y can gain up to 275 km of driving range in just 15 minutes. This makes it possible to comfortably travel distances such as Gurugram to Jaipur’s Hawa Mahal with minimal downtime.
Plug In, Charge and Go: Tesla’s Seamless Charging Experience
Tesla continues to focus on user convenience by offering a fully integrated charging experience. With a claimed 99.95% network uptime, owners can manage everything through the Tesla mobile app, including:
- Navigation to charging locations
- Real-time stall availability
- Monitoring charging progress
- Remote vehicle preconditioning
- Secure payments and charge completion alerts
This streamlined process ensures stress-free charging for EV owners.

Tesla Now Operates Three Major Charging Stations in India
With the Gurugram station now live, Tesla’s Indian charging network includes three key locations, featuring a total of 12 Superchargers and 10 Destination Chargers:
- Gurugram – One Horizon: 4 Superchargers, 3 Destination Chargers
- Delhi – Worldmark 3: 4 Superchargers, 3 Destination Chargers
- Mumbai – One BKC: 4 Superchargers, 4 Destination Chargers
This growing network strengthens Tesla’s commitment to India’s EV infrastructure.
Interactive EV Workshops for Public Awareness
To educate residents and EV enthusiasts, Tesla is organizing interactive workshops at the Horizon Center Charging Station from December 17 to December 21. These sessions will demonstrate charger usage and provide insights into electric vehicles, sustainable energy, and future mobility trends.

Tesla Model Y Price in India Revealed
Alongside the infrastructure expansion, Tesla has confirmed the starting price of the Model Y in India at INR 59,89,000. The company is also offering home charging support, ensuring a smooth and convenient ownership experience for customers.
